1925 – 2016
PORTLAND — Yvette L. Longtin, 91, of Portland, formerly of Lewiston, passed on Thursday, Feb. 25, at The Cedars with her four children by her.
She was born on Feb. 8, 1925, in Berlin, N.H., to Alphonse and Marie Anne Lessard. On June 14, 1948, she married her husband of 62 years, Henry J. Longtin Jr.
Yvette enjoyed caring for little children, especially babies, and she loved music. She loved telling stories of her fond memories growing up on a family farm in Montpelier, Vt., with her parents and eight siblings. She had a number of positions in laundry and housekeeping and caring for children in her home.
She is survived by her children, Michael Longtin of Saco, Ronald Longtin of Old Orchard Beach, Doris Longtin of Scarborough, Rachel Walker and companion, Roger Sorrells, of Poland; grandson, Nicholas Walker and wife, Jackie; and great-grandchildren, Rocky and Nora Walker of Houston, Texas; sisters, Doris Fournier of Helotes, Texas, and Claire Rossignol of Bucksport; and many nieces and nephews.
Yvette was predeceased by her parents; her husband, Henry Longtin Jr.; brothers, Leo, Roland and Gerard Lessard; sisters, Irene Demers, Lorraine Angers and Muriel Gagne; and a son-in-law, Clifford “Rocky” Walker.
